Ikea Group has selected Anomaly to lead its first ever global account, created to develop a corporate and consumer communications platform focused on sustainability.

ikea

Ikea hands global brief to Anomaly

As a new strategic account, the win will not affect the work of local incumbent creative agencies, including Mother in the UK.

Ikea began conversations with agencies in February 2017 and awarded the account following a competitive pitch. According to Anomaly, the furniture brand was seeking ‘an agency with global understanding and reach into Ikea's key markets in EMEA, USA and Asia’.

The brief will run for a minimum of three years and will be carried out across Anomaly’s global offices. Creative work will also be produced alongside strategy, with digital and film already being discussed.

Anomaly Amsterdam led the agency’s pitch.

Claudia Willvonseder, global marketing and communication manager at Ikea Group, said: “In Anomaly, we have found a creative partner that brings an integrated approach to our global and local communications work.”

Fabian Berglund, executive creative director at Anomaly Amsterdam, added: "To get to work with the company that founded the idea of democratic design is not just a great opportunity for Anomaly, but for me - as a Swede - it's a dream come true.”
